****** Append File Version 1.0 *******
A Utility To Combine ASCII Text Files
Copyright (c) 1993 Kevin Myers, All Rights Reserved

Preface:
Append File is a down and dirty utility to attach one ASCII file to
another ASCII file. Append File is designed to give maximum flexibility
and speed. Append File uses three methods of operation to give you this
flexibility. The first is the command line option, second is via a data
file (much like the "MAKE" file programmers know), third is through the
familiar wild card.
To Install:
To install Append File, uncompress it in a directory in your path.
This can be a newly created directory or an existing one, like C:\UTIL.
I don't recommend using your DOS directory.
To Run Append File:
Append File is operated by typing APNDFILE at the DOS prompt and
pressing <enter>. This will give you the information screen:
APENDFILE - Copyright Kevin Myers (c) 1993. Version B4.00
Usage - APNDFILE -e [-p] [-t] [-m] [-l] [-n] [-w]
-eXXXXXXXX.XXX Name of append file \'APPEND.TXT\'.
-pnn Page numbers. Lines per page.
-t\"XXX...\" Title of next file to be appended. May be used multiple times.
-mXXXXXXX.XXX File being attached. May be used multiple times.
-lXXXXXXXX.XXX File list.
-wXXXXXXX.XXX Enables wild cards to be used.
-n Places wild card file name at the top of each section.
Use switches in order of appearance, -t & -m may be used multiple times.
The -t preceding an -m will attach that title to that file. -t preceding an -w
will attach that title to the top of all the files.
-l, file list can be used in place of the command line switches. Create
a file with the same switches as the command line but one per line ending
with a carriage return <enter>.
The options -l, and -w can only be used by registered users. This copy
is ** REGISTERED **.
As mentioned before, Append File offers three methods of processing
files. The first is the command line option:
APNDFILE -efile.txt -p60 -t"This the first file" -mread1st.doc
-t"This is the second file" -mprog.doc
Also, a space may be present between the switch and the text:
APNDFILE -e file.txt -p 60 -t "This the first file" -m read1st.doc
-t "This is the second file" -m prog.doc
This will allow you to enter as many files as your DOS environment will
allow. Please note that only the command line routine works with the
evaluation program. A batch file may be used to extend the DOS limit.
The second and third methods are only available in the registered
version only. The second method uses a file to hold your options:
APNDFILE -l afile.dat
The file afile.dat contains:
-e file.txt
-p 60
-t "This the first file"
-m read1st.doc
-t "This is the second file"
-m prog.doc
For up to seventy lines. Each line must end with a carriage return /
line feed <enter>. Strings of words with spaces in them must be enclosed
in quotes "like this". And, there may or may not be spaces between the
switch and the processing information, i.e. -e file.nam and -efile.nam
are the same.
The third and last method is the wild card option. Just use the -w
switch with the options of your choice:
APNDFILE -e wildfile.txt -n -w *.txt
This will append together all files ending with .TXT and put there
filenames at the beginning of each. The application of this option is
obvious, the BBS. The -n switch places the DOS filename at the top of each
appended file. The -t option places a title at the top of the whole file
only.
